How much does it cost to rent a home in Catlin?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Catlin 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$748 | $495 | $1,050 |
Catlin 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,240 | $750 | $3,000 |
Catlin 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,547 | $995 | $4,100 |
Catlin 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,350 | $3,350 | $3,350 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Catlin
What type of rentals are currently available in Catlin?
There are currently 45 Apartments for Rent in Catlin, IL with pricing that ranges from $525 to $1,795. There are also 35 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Catlin ranging from $495 to $4,100.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Catlin?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Catlin ranges from $495 to $4,100 with an average monthly rent of $1,971.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Catlin?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Catlin range from $875 to $1,730,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$750 to $3,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$995 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$739.
